Connect students in grades 5 and up with science using Simple Machines: Force, Motion, and Energy. This 80-page book reinforces scientific techniques. It includes teacher pages that provide quick overviews of the lessons and student pages with Knowledge Builders and Inquiry Investigations that can be completed individually or in groups. The book also includes tips for lesson preparation (materials lists, strategies, and alternative methods of instruction), a glossary, an inquiry investigation rubric, and a bibliography. It allows for differentiated instruction and supports National Science Education Standards and NCTM standards.

Aimed at the needs, challenges and concerns of grade school teachers, this is a large collection of inexpensive and delightful activities ideas for teaching K-5 science. The science involved is explained within the activities texts to help those who may not be confident of their own understanding of the material. It includes ideas for remembering and summarizing activities as well as discovery activities. While the focus is primarily on the physical and earth sciences, attention is also given to life sciences as well. Developed at Oglethorpe University in Atlanta, Georgia, for the most part it conforms to the Georgia Performance Standards in topical coverage although it is not confined by them.
